Output ef5031cf63ed723b757dc138072e4090926db42c3736984c432a6b3e9c2aa7a3:0

value
25900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d47e4604f2153e71bde898753af95f30c062f107 OP_EQUAL
address
3M4aSrDHSv27j5yqY5ZNLQVp3NuDjXwmK9
transaction
ef5031cf63ed723b757dc138072e4090926db42c3736984c432a6b3e9c2aa7a3
spent
true